Abstract
This paper presents a novel image steganography approach for hiding a secret image in the cover image. It benefits from the fact that the occurrence of some local features in the image demonstrates remarkable patterns for determining the payload of the cover image sub-regions based on Human Visual System (HVS). However, the goal of this paper is to propose a system deals with improving the visual quality of the stego-image, while still providing a large embedding capacity. To achieve this goal, a Fuzzy Inference System (FIS) is designed as a classifier which adopts the local features of the cover image sub-regions as its crisp input values and produces semantic concepts corresponding to the payload of image sub-regions. This ensures to decrease the rate of changes in the stego-image, even after embedding a large amount of secret bits. The experimental results demonstrate the effectiveness of the proposed approach.
